Replace obsolete WebGPU flags with state-of-the-art NVIDIA VA-API
hardware decode config for Chrome 148 on Wayland/Hyprland.
- Disable seccomp sandbox to fix NVIDIA GBM "Permission denied" error
- Disable VulkanFromANGLE/DefaultANGLEVulkan (incompatible with Wayland)
- Force ANGLE->OpenGL backend to avoid Vulkan/Wayland conflicts
- Enable modern VA-API flags: VaapiOnNvidiaGPUs, AcceleratedVideoDecodeLinux*
- Add gnome-libsecret password store for gnome-keyring integration
- Install libva-utils and libva-nvidia-driver packages
- Update driver version to 580.159.03 in hardware inventory
WebGPU remains hardware accelerated via ANGLE+OpenGL. Chrome verified
working with full video decode acceleration (H.264, VP9, HEVC) via NVDEC.
Architecture: Bitwarden (central vault) → rbw CLI → gnome-keyring
(local cache via org.freedesktop.secrets D-Bus). All apps (himalaya,
git, ssh-agent, JetBrains IDEs, browsers) now read secrets via
libsecret/secret-tool through gnome-keyring.
Changes:
- Install gnome-keyring + rbw, enable as systemd user service
- Configure rbw → bitwarden.jantec.xyz (ironmikechw+bitwarden@gmail.com)
- Migrate 45 meaningful entries from KWallet → BW + GK
- Switch git credential.helper from store to libsecret
- Document: one-pager, ADR, migration checklist, NEXT_STEPS update
- Skill: devops/secrets-migration for reuse
Post-reboot manual: himalaya IMAP passwords (4 accounts, were not in
KWallet) and GitHub CLI token re-auth.

Hyprland 0.53+ requires launching via start-hyprland (watchdog) for
proper crash diagnostics and signal handling. Without it a warning
banner appears on login.
Override package-managed hyprland.desktop with local copy pointing to
start-hyprland. XDG_DATA_DIRS priority ensures the override wins
without modifying system files.
